Transaction 84d6650a82a3b79b637878315ab15c8c54c974dc04f909bdbc768dd5e7aba330
1 Input
1 Output
-
84d6650a82a3b79b637878315ab15c8c54c974dc04f909bdbc768dd5e7aba330:0
- value
- 469890
- script pubkey
- OP_0 OP_PUSHBYTES_20 dadce363e7becb1b4240284d20ccfb48af1dc544
- address
- bc1qmtwwxcl8hm93ksjq9pxjpn8mfzh3m32yrehnfw